程序師世界是廣大編程愛好者互助、分享、學習的平台,程序師世界有你更精彩!
首頁
編程語言
C語言|JAVA編程
Python編程
網頁編程
ASP編程|PHP編程
JSP編程
數據庫知識
MYSQL數據庫|SqlServer數據庫
Oracle數據庫|DB2數據庫
 程式師世界 >> 編程語言 >> 更多編程語言 >> 編程解疑 >> c#-C#問題,用黃色替代這個代碼怎麼結果不一樣了呢

c#-C#問題,用黃色替代這個代碼怎麼結果不一樣了呢

編輯:編程解疑
C#問題,用黃色替代這個代碼怎麼結果不一樣了呢

這個程序和用黃色輸出的結果怎麼不一樣呢?
關鍵是能詳細講一下各自的步驟麼。。。圖片

最佳回答:


這個程序輸出的順序是:
B
A
C
在mian函數裡創建一個cc 對象時,因為類C中有b成員,所以先產生b對象,此事輸出'B',然後調用C的構造函數創建cc對象時,先要調用A的構造函數,
所以先輸出'A’,然後再調用C的構造函數,輸出'C'
另外,不知道你的string[] s1=s.split('.');有何意義?

qq_33914471
  1. 上一頁:
  2. 下一頁:
Copyright © 程式師世界 All Rights Reserved